As part of the ongoing Purattasi Brahmotsavam at Tirumala, Day 2 utsavam was celebrated well today (October 6, 2013; Vijaya Varusha Purattasi Chithrai). There was Chinna Sesha Vahanam purappadu in the morning and Hamsa Vahanam in the evening. Thirumanjanam for Sri Srinivasar and Ubhaya Nachiyars took place in the afternoon.
This year (Vijaya Varusham), the Brahmotsavam commenced on October 5, 2013 (Saturday) with Dwajarohanam and will conclude on October 13, 2013. Ankurarpana and Senadhipati (Vishvaksenar) Utsavam took place on the day preceding day of Day 1 (October 4, 2013). Some of the important utsavams are Garuda Sevai on October 9, 2013; Thanga Ther on October 10, 2013; Rathotsavam on October 12, 2013: and Chakrasnanam on October 13, 2013. Several hundreds of devotees from across the country and outside visit Tirumala for this utsavam.
Recently on September 30, 2013, Therottam for the Noothana Swarna Ratham took place well whereby the golden chariot was taken on a procession along four mada streets and kept inside the newly constructed Swarnaratha mandapam behind Vahana Mandapam.
